Abstract

Diabetes mellitus (DM) is a metabolic disorder with a rising prevalence globally. Currently about 400 million people are affected. In 2016, it was the seventh leading cause of death worldwide. Diabetes mellitus is prevalent in most countries. Its major feature is the high level of blood glucose which can be caused by insulin resistance or reduced insulin production. As the disease progresses, complications like diabetic neuropathy, nephropathy, and retinopathy occur. The use of herbs and natural products in the management of diabetes mellitus dates to the prehistoric era. Eighteen studies from about nine countries showed that between 18% and 72% use traditional and complementary medicine in the management of diabetes. In developing countries where the disease is highly prevalent natural products are very common because of ready availability, cheapness, and minimal side effects. This review highlights alkaloids, one of the most important secondary metabolites isolated from plants which have been studied to have anti-diabetes effects. Alkaloids are a group of highly diverse natural products that contain one or more basic nitrogen atoms in a heterocyclic ring. The various plants that contain them, their pharmacological actions studied thus far, mechanism of action will be extensively discussed. The aim of this review is to provide rich knowledge on research carried out thus far on plant alkaloids in the management of diabetes: Their pharmacology, chemistry, and effectiveness which will serve as a platform for further research and development of novel drug molecules that can further help in the management of this disease.
